Understanding Mycotoxins





Recognizing mycotoxins starts with identifying that they are toxic additional metabolites generated by particular mold and mildews, which can pollute agricultural products. These metabolites are not important for the development or recreation of the fungi however can have serious implications for human and animal health. Mycotoxins are commonly found in staple plants such as corn, wheat, barley, and nuts, where they can multiply under certain conditions of moisture and temperature level.


There are numerous sorts of mycotoxins, each created by different fungal species. Aflatoxins, generated by Aspergillus types, are among the most notorious, recognized for their cancer causing residential or commercial properties. Another substantial group includes ochratoxins, generated by Aspergillus and Penicillium species, which have nephrotoxic impacts. Fusarium species generate trichothecenes and fumonisins, both of which are connected with various intense and persistent health concerns.

Comprehending the ecological problems that favor mycotoxin production is vital for designing efficient control methods. Variables such as moisture, temperature level, and the existence of bugs can influence fungal growth and mycotoxin manufacturing (Mycotoxin testing Services). An incorporated strategy involving agricultural techniques, storage space monitoring, and routine testing can reduce the risks connected with mycotoxin contamination, making certain food safety and security and public health and wellness

Techniques of Mycotoxin Evaluating



Accurately identifying mycotoxin contamination in agricultural items is crucial for guarding public wellness and preserving food security standards. Various approaches are used to find and measure mycotoxins, each offering certain advantages and restrictions.


High-Performance Liquid Chromatography (HPLC) is a widely made use of approach because of its high sensitivity and accuracy. It includes separating mycotoxins from other why not try these out compounds in a sample, making it possible for exact quantification. Liquid Chromatography-Mass Spectrometry (LC-MS) combines fluid chromatography with mass spectrometry to provide thorough molecular info, making it particularly valuable for determining numerous mycotoxins at the same time.

Enzyme-Linked Immunosorbent Assays (ELISA) are an additional usual approach, recognized for their rapid outcomes and convenience of use. ELISAs utilize antibodies to discover certain mycotoxins, making them appropriate for high-throughput testing.


Gas Chromatography-Mass Spectrometry (GC-MS) and Thin-Layer Chromatography (TLC) are also employed, each with unique applications. GC-MS works for unpredictable mycotoxins, while tender loving care uses an easier, affordable choice for preliminary testing.
